diff --git a/scripts/speed_reader.py b/scripts/speed_reader.py index aaacf5d..0a3115c 100644 --- a/scripts/speed_reader.py +++ b/scripts/speed_reader.py @@ -6,6 +6,7 @@ pulses_per_rotation = 4 reader = Button(4, pull_up=False, bounce_time=0.0005) set_variable("speed_reader_last_impulse_time", datetime.datetime.now(), False) set_variable("actual_rpm_unfiltered", 0, False) +set_variable("impulses", 1, False) def event(): @@ -23,11 +24,10 @@ def event(): print(round(actual_rpm, 1)) -impulses = 0 def new_event(): - impulses = impulses + 1 - print(impulses) + set_variable("impulses", int(get_variable("impulses")) + 1, False) + print(get_variable("impulses"))